Welcome aboard! PortionPal is our recipe-scaling calculator — folks at Marrowbridge Kitchenworks use it to scale batches from four servings to four hundred without breaking ratios. As release manager, you'll cut a tagged build every other Thursday. The math core rarely changes; most releases are unit-conversion tables and UI tweaks. Builds won't publish unless they're signed, and the pipeline checks the signature against our registry, so don't skip that step. To get you unblocked right away, here's the signing key we use for releases:

deploy key for kajof-fajop: bky6_gDHw9Q

Ticket: intermittent connection failures — Wrenmoor API

Hey on-call, heads up: the Wrenmoor workers keep failing to reach the reports database, but only about one attempt in twenty. Looks like flaky DNS — the resolver in the Tarnbeck cluster sometimes returns stale records after a failover. Retries mask it, but latency spikes. Try bypassing the resolver and connecting directly; the direct connection string is below.

primary connection of yagep-kahip = redis://giliel_svc:zYiKsLL2PLpfPL@db-348f.xolmarsys.corp:5432/fenwyn

Alert: UndoStackDrift detected in Sketchline's diagram editor. The undo and redo stacks have diverged after a collaborative merge, meaning redo operations may replay stale node positions. This fires when stack checksums mismatch for more than 200 sessions in a ten-minute window. Before approving the 4.2 release candidate, confirm the reconciliation job has cleared the drift counter and that no customer-facing corruption reports are open. Full triage steps are on the internal page below.

operations page: https://sentry.nelvronet.corp/settings/deploy/run/repo/pipeline/display/view/4489f1fe1c19e0ed84102aec